Draft at source. Some surface covering lacing. A light hazy to the golden beer giving it medium clarity. Aroma is a dry paper biscuit with a second wave of the more traditional slightly sweet biscuit. That dry paper character may be a house flavor. Flavor is low sweet with light bitterness. Short finish that is lightly drying. Hops felt a bit but nothing l would call bitter. A little sweet dough sticks around. A light mineral quality and alight seltzer feel. Some drying herbal/noble character. Its mild and completely easy to drink.
